Poland Business Confidence July 2020

Poland: Business sentiment recovers further ground but remains pessimistic in July

Manufacturing-sector business confidence recovered some additional ground in July, although it remained deeply entrenched in pessimist terrain. According to the business tendency indicator released by Statistics Poland, June’s business climate indicator rose from June’s minus 19.9 to minus 10.5. The indicator therefore remained below the zero mark that distinguishes pessimism from optimism in the manufacturing sector.

July’s rise came on the back of an improvement in both businesses’ expectations of future conditions and businesses’ assessment of current conditions. Businesses’ expectations regarding the future general economic situation, employment, production levels and orders books all improved considerably although remained entrenched in pessimistic territory. Additionally, their assessments of the current general economic situation, order books, production levels and of their financial situation recovered significant terrain, although they also remained in negative terrain.
